H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D CRIMINAL MISC. ANTICIPATORY BAIL APPLICATION U/S 482 BNSS No. - 5215 of 2026 Harshit @ Shraddesh Thakur .....Applicant(s) Versus State of U.P. and Another .....Opposite Party(s) Counsel for Applicant(s) : Anita Singh, Prem Babu Verma Counsel for Opposite Party(s) : G.A. Court No. - 71 HON'BLE AVNISH SAXENA, J. 1. Heard Ms. Anita Singh, learned counsel for the applicant and Learned AGA for the State. 2. The present anticipatory bail application under Section 482 of BNSS has been filed by the applicant with a prayer to release him on anticipatory bail in Case Crime No. 397 of 2024, Case No.21556 of 2025, under Sections 308, 352, 323, 504, 506 IPC, P.S.- North, District- Firozabad, during pendency of the trial. 3. It is contended by learned counsel for the applicant that the accused applicant has been falsely implicated by the informant in the FIR dated 23.6.2024 with the allegation that the son of the informant was walking to the shop of informant when the motorcycle borne persons including the accused applicant hit him by motorcycle.
